반응형
MariaDB 루트 로그인 문제(로그인은 가능하지만 보안은 불가)
문제가 좀 있어요.
MariaDB 설치 성공.
mysql_secure_installation
설정이 완료되었습니다.
로그인을 합니다.mysql -u root -p
삽입 Linux 루트 사용자에게는 모든 비밀번호가 로그인할 수 있습니다.
(루트 사용자는 올바른 비밀번호를 입력할 필요가 없습니다)
이 문제는 에서는 발생하지 않습니다.MariaDB v10.3
그렇지만MariaDB v10.4
오버버전
나는 이 상황이 보안이 아니라고 생각한다.
해결책을 찾을 수 있을까요?
이것은, 다음의 이유로,Plugin
root 사용자가 설정하기 위해unix_socket
.
MariaDB [(none)]> select User,Host,Password,Plugin from mysql.user;
+---------------+-----------+-------------------------------------------+-------------+
| User | Host | Password | Plugin |
+---------------+-----------+-------------------------------------------+-------------+
| root | localhost | *X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X | unix_socket |
그래도 끌 수 있습니다.
ALTER USER root@localhost IDENTIFIED VIA mysql_native_password;
매뉴얼은 이쪽:https://mariadb.com/kb/en/authentication-plugin-unix-socket/
언급URL : https://stackoverflow.com/questions/62929530/mariadb-root-login-problem-can-login-but-not-security
반응형
'programing' 카테고리의 다른 글
Python glob 다중 파일 형식 (0) | 2022.11.04 |
---|---|
PHP를 통한 HTTP 인증 로그아웃 (0) | 2022.11.04 |
JSON 본문을 사용한 POST 요구 (0) | 2022.11.04 |
jQuery - 텍스트 설명을 통해 선택한 컨트롤의 값을 설정합니다. (0) | 2022.11.04 |
Tomcat에서 Spring Boot를 시작할 때 사용자 이름과 비밀번호는 무엇입니까? (0) | 2022.10.26 |